History
The Saint Anselm College Polling is a research survey organization based in Manchester, New Hampshire. According to their about page, “The Center conducts an annual survey of New Hampshire registered voters’ views on housing policy.”

Funded by / Ownership
Saint Anselm College Polling is operated and funded by The Center for Ethics in Society.. Revenue is derived through sales of services.
Analysis / Bias
Saint Anselm College Polling conducts market research and polling via various mediums. The website does not generally report on politics but publishes news related to its polling.
FiveThirtyEight, an expert on measuring and rating pollster performance, has evaluated 17 polls by Saint Anselm College Polling, earning 2.4 stars for accuracy, indicating they are High factually by MBFC’s criteria. They also conclude that their polling slightly favors the Left with a score of +0.6, which equates to Least Biased overall in polling bias. In general, the Saint Anselm College Polling is considered to be highly accurate and demonstrates minimal bias in polling.
